Question Motor mechanic licence QLD?

Hi I am a motor mechanic and I am trying to find out if I will need a licence to work in QLD any advice would be great

Hi Sean,

According to http://www.immi.gov.au/asri/occupati...ic-4211-11.htm you only need certification for New South Wales. There is no legal requirement for licensing or registration as a motor mechanic for the other states/territories.
